CSFD using drones to put out fires and save more lives
Apr 14, 2025
(CO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o) — Sometimes during the day, you might see a drone up in the sky flying around your neighborhood for different reasons, but a drone being used by the Colorado Springs Fire Department (CSFD) is helping save lives.
CSFD started using drones in 2023, and since then, they ha
ve never responded to calls the same.
"The fire chief might not be on scene, but he can watch it through our live streams," said Lieutenant Drew Cahill.

CSFD says the drone team responded to 471 incidents in 2024 in order to help put out fires quicker and more efficiently.
The drone was used during the West Monument Creek Fire on the Air Force Academy Base. It allowed firefighters to see flames and hot spots in places that are not easy to see or access.
"We're not putting any lives at risk to get that information," Cahill said.
Along with fires, the drones are also used to rescue hikers in the mountains. Thermal technology allows firefighters to detect people through the tree branches and guide them to safety or let them know help is on the way.

The drones are also able to provide immediate assistance to those lost in the woods.
"With the new drop system we have, we're going to be able to deliver items to people," Cahill said.
Cahill and the drone team have been called to various situations, including housefires, monitoring the aftermath of lightning strikes, helping police find criminals, or even in hazmat situations.
"I can fly and keep that overhead view," Cahill said. "We can see a lot greater area and see everything that's going on."
For CSFD, any data provided for these drones helps in their goal of serving while taking precautions in any way possible.
"Any time that we cannot put any person's life at risk is definitely a huge benefit," Cahill said.
Right now, the department has four drones and hopes to add more as Cahill tells FOX21 News he would like to get a smaller one to use in case of a large warehouse or other structure fires. ...read more read less
